Amlopres is a medication that combines two active ingredients: Amlodipine and Atenolol. It is commonly prescribed as a combination therapy for the management of hypertension (high blood pressure). Amlodipine is a calcium channel blocker, and Atenolol is a beta-blocker, and together they work synergistically to control blood pressure.

What is Amlopres used for? Amlopres is primarily prescribed for the treatment of hypertension. By combining a calcium channel blocker and a beta-blocker, it addresses blood pressure from different mechanisms, providing effective control for individuals with high blood pressure.

Precautions:

  • Inform your healthcare provider about any existing medical conditions, especially if you have a history of heart problems, liver disease, or asthma.
  • Regularly monitor your blood pressure as directed by your healthcare provider.
  • Avoid abrupt discontinuation of Amlopres, as it may lead to an increase in blood pressure.

What Are The Side Effects Of Amlopres? Common side effects may include dizziness, fatigue, and swelling in the ankles. Serious side effects such as a slow heart rate or allergic reactions are rare but require medical attention. Report any unusual or persistent side effects to your healthcare provider.

  • Q.1.) What happens if you take too much Amlopres? A: Taking more than the prescribed dose of Amlopres can lead to symptoms such as excessively low blood pressure, slow heart rate, and dizziness. Seek immediate medical attention if an overdose is suspected.

    Q.2.) What if you forget to take Amlopres tablet? A: If you miss a dose, take it as soon as you remember. However, if it's almost time for your next scheduled dose, skip the missed one and continue with your regular dosing schedule.

    Q.3.) How Does Amlopres Work? A: Amlopres works through the combination of Amlodipine, which relaxes blood vessels, and Atenolol, which reduces the heart rate and cardiac output. This dual action helps in lowering blood pressure.

    Q.4.) How to Take Amlopres? A: Take Amlopres as directed by your healthcare provider. It is usually taken orally, with or without food. Swallow the tablet whole with a glass of water.

    Q.5.) What Are the Common Drug Interactions? A: Amlopres may interact with certain medications, including other antihypertensive drugs, certain diuretics, and medications that affect heart rate. Inform your healthcare provider about all the medications you are taking to avoid potential interactions.
